One of the most common uses for scanners is detecting "ghosts." Sometimes, a user appears to have left the room, but their avatar remains "stuck" in the server. They can still see the chat but can't move. Conversely, some users use stealth modes to spy on rooms. A scanner reveals the User ID of every avatar instance in the room, exposing who is lurking, who is using an alt account, and who is truly offline.
Most popular third-party scanners, such as those found on platforms like , VuArchives , or BotPower , offer a suite of monitoring tools: imvu room scanner
[1] IMVU Inc., “Terms of Service,” 2024. [2] R. Bartle, “Designing Virtual Worlds,” New Riders, 2003. [3] OpenMetaverse Foundation, “Second Life Protocol Documentation,” 2022. One of the most common uses for scanners
IMVU’s API uses a custom binary format (likely Protocol Buffers or MessagePack over WebSockets). Using a debug version of the client or a disassembler, we identified that room state updates are sent via RoomDataUpdate messages. A scanner reveals the User ID of every